مقدمه انگلیسی مقاله:

1. Introduction

Carbon fiber reinforced polymer composites have been extensively used in a wide range of applications such as aerospace, automotive, wind energy, marine turbine blades and sports sector because of their superior strength to weight, high thermal stability and excellent corrosion resistance [1,2]. Their low fabrication cost, ease of handling and fatigue damage resistance owe to metal counterpart in various applications [3e5]. In the composites, fiber plays an important role as load bearing component and polymer matrix provides back support to fiber by maintaining its orientation into the composites. The fiber volume content is essentially dominated the mechanical properties of unidirectional carbon fiber polymer matrix composite. In the laminated composites, carbon fiber is mainly responsible for high in-plane mechanical properties, whereas polymer matrix is mainly for out of plane properties. The carbon fiber laminated composites are extremely capable to crack initiation and propagation through various modes of failure [6,7]. The delamination is one of the major crack growth mode, which causes critical depression in in-plane strength and stiffness [8,9]. Another problem is the surface inertness of carbon fiber which exhibits poor interfacial interactions with polymer matrix [10]. All above drawbacks are potentially led to catastrophic failure of the whole composite structure. In this direction several techniques have been introduced to improve mechanical properties (inplane and out of plane) such as Z pinning [11], stitching of fiber [12], designing 3D fabric design [13], fiber surface modification [14e16] and matrix modifications [17e19] etc. These modification methods have been reported with improved inter-laminar mechanical properties at high complexity and cost. Traditionally, matrixmodification is relatively easy and cost effective procedure without compromising other mechanical and structural properties of composite. It is reported that improvement in mechanical properties of composites using matrix modification depends largely on the interface to volume ratio and filler size [20,21]. So in this direction nanofillers are playing important role for the modification in polymer matrix. Some of the work has been already reported on the modifications of composite interface by reinforcing mechanism. The modification combines effect was explained from a variety of interface theories such as chemical bonding [22], wetting, mechanical interlock [23] and local stiffness of polymer matrix [24]. In this area, enhancement in mechanical properties of composites has been reported by incorporating nanoscale fillers such as CNT [25e27], fullerenes [28,29] and nanoclay [30,31]. Ogasawara et al. has reported 60% enhancement in interleminar fracture toughness by incorporating fullerene (0.1e1 wt%) in the matrix resin [28]. On the other hand Vaganov et al. examined the enhancement of 40% in fracture toughness by incorporating 1.0 wt% CNT in epoxy/carbon fiber composites [32]. Also, Xua et al.
